Deer Coloring Sheets for Different Age Groups
Deer coloring sheets can be adapted for various age groups. For toddlers, simple shapes with thick outlines are best. School-aged children can handle more detail, including background elements like trees and grass. Teenagers and adults may enjoy realistic depictions with shading and texture. This adaptability ensures that deer coloring sheets remain a relevant and engaging activity throughout a person’s life.

Creating Your Own Deer Coloring Sheets
For those with artistic skills, designing custom deer coloring sheets can be a rewarding project. Start with a basic deer outline, then add details like antlers, fur texture, and background elements. Digital tools can help refine the design before printing. Sharing these custom sheets with others can also be a way to contribute to educational or community resources.
